Front suspension
Hi. I have just installed my refreshed engine and rebuilt the front suspension do I tighten all the suspension components when the car is sitting on its wheels with the full weight of the engine or do I jack up the car then tighten Thanks

Re: Front suspension
Tighten all the suspension nuts/bolts just past finger tight when the car is on axle stands/Jack.
Lower the car to the ground so that the suspension is supporting the weight of the car. Bounce the car a couple of times to settle the car and normalise the suspension/ride height.
You then need to fully tighten all the suspension nuts/bolts again when the car is on the ground and the suspension is taking the weight of the car.
